Apache Hadoop YARN LiveLessons (Video Training)

Video description

Apache Hadoop YARN Fundamentals LiveLessonsis the first complete video training course on the basics of Apache Hadoop version 2 with YARN. The tutorial begins with MapReduce and Big Data fundamentals and moves to YARN design, installation (laptop, cluster, and cloud), administration, running applications (MapReduce2, Pig and Hive), writing new applications, and useful frameworks. Additional coverage of Ambari, Ganglia, Nagios and the Hortonworks HDP is provided.

About the Instructor

Douglas Eadlineis the instructor for this essential Big Data LiveLessons. Eadline is a practitioner and writer in the Linux Cluster community and previously authored Hadoop Fundamentals LiveLessons which focused on many of the basic aspects of Hadoop processing. Eadline is a co-authorof the companion book Apache Hadoop YARN, Moving beyond MapReduce and Batch Processing with Apache Hadoop 2. Doug provides a clear and complete introduction to many of the important Apache Hadoop YARN tasks and topics. In addition to a sound background on Hadoop design, he provides several installation scenarios including a laptop, cluster, and cloud. The Ambari graphic installation tool is explained and used for both installation and administration. You will also learn how to write your own YARN applications and what is needed to run Hadoop version 1 applications. Some familiarity with Java, Hadoop MapReduce and the Hadoop Distributed File System is helpful but not necessary. All example code and Lesson notes are available for download.
